排序
wordpress用的什么框架
wordpress用的什么框架? wordpress本身就是一個框架,它是自成體系的。 WordPress沒有用任何通用框架也不依賴composer,其自身完全是使用原生PHP開發(fā),特點是支持插件和多主題以及依賴少方便部署...
基于ThinkPHP6和Swoole的高并發(fā)RPC服務(wù)實踐
基于ThinkPHP6和Swoole的高并發(fā)RPC服務(wù)實踐 引言:在現(xiàn)代的Web應(yīng)用開發(fā)中,高并發(fā)是一個非常重要的問題。隨著互聯(lián)網(wǎng)的快速發(fā)展和用戶量的增加,傳統(tǒng)的Web架構(gòu)已經(jīng)無法滿足對高并發(fā)的需求。為了...
使用DiscoPower模塊,SimpleSAMLphp如何優(yōu)雅地增強IdP發(fā)現(xiàn)服務(wù)
在使用 simplesamlphp 構(gòu)建單點登錄(sso)系統(tǒng)時,我面臨一個挑戰(zhàn):如何為用戶提供一個清晰、易用的 idp 選擇界面。simplesamlphp 內(nèi)置的發(fā)現(xiàn)服務(wù)功能比較基礎(chǔ),難以滿足以下需求: 分組顯示 I...
如何在Laravel中執(zhí)行數(shù)據(jù)庫遷移
laravel數(shù)據(jù)庫遷移通過php代碼管理數(shù)據(jù)庫結(jié)構(gòu)變更,提供版本控制功能。1. 創(chuàng)建遷移文件:使用artisan命令生成帶時間戳的遷移文件并定義up()和down()方法;2. 執(zhí)行遷移:運行migrate命令按順序執(zhí)...
解決composer報錯:超出內(nèi)存大小的問題(Allowed memory size )
?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? ? 下面由composer教程欄目給大家介紹關(guān)于composer 報錯:超出內(nèi)存大小的問題(Allowed memory size ),...
高效處理異步操作:Guzzle Promises 庫的實踐
我的應(yīng)用需要從三個不同的api獲取數(shù)據(jù),每個api的響應(yīng)時間都不確定。最初,我的代碼是同步執(zhí)行這三個請求,這意味著程序必須等待第一個請求完成才能發(fā)出第二個請求,依次類推。這導(dǎo)致了總響應(yīng)時...
使用Symfony/css-selector庫簡化前端開發(fā)中的CSS選擇器轉(zhuǎn)換
可以通過一下地址學(xué)習composer:學(xué)習地址 在前端開發(fā)過程中,常常需要將 css 選擇器轉(zhuǎn)換為 xpath 表達式以便在后端進行處理。然而,手動轉(zhuǎn)換不僅耗時而且容易出錯。最近在開發(fā)一個需要頻繁進行...
thinkphp是cms么
thinkphp不是cms。thinkphp和cms是不一樣的概念,thinkphp是一種PHP程序開發(fā)使用的框架,用于簡化企業(yè)級應(yīng)用開發(fā)和敏捷WEB應(yīng)用開發(fā);而cms指的是內(nèi)容管理系統(tǒng),是一種PHP成品程序。 本教程操作...
探討Laravel擴展包失效的原因和解決方法
隨著laravel的快速發(fā)展和廣泛應(yīng)用,越來越多的開發(fā)者開始使用laravel擴展包來優(yōu)化和拓展laravel的功能。不過,我們在使用laravel擴展包時,難免會遇到擴展包失效的問題。本文將探討laravel擴展...
如何解決PHP項目中條形碼生成問題?使用Composer和laminas/laminas-barcode可以!
可以通過一下地址學(xué)習composer:學(xué)習地址 在開發(fā)一個電商系統(tǒng)時,我遇到了一個棘手的問題:如何高效生成和渲染條形碼。這個功能對庫存管理和訂單處理至關(guān)重要,但我嘗試的多種方法效果都不理想...